>> symbolic doesn't work with Octave > 3.2.4, which is why I don't have a
>> Fink package for it.
>>
>> But let's see if you have a problem with your mkoctfile.  What do you
>> get from running "grep i386 /sw/bin/mkoctfile" ?

> I don't know whether the package works, but on my self-built octave-3.6.2 
> under Linux it, at least, can be built and installed:
> 
> "
> ---
> Package name:
>         symbolic
> Version:
>         1.1.0
> Short description:
>         Symbolic toolbox based on GiNaC and CLN.
> Status:
>         Loaded
> octave:2>             
> 
> ".
> 
> ...
> 
> At least some things in the package do work, e.g.:
> 
> "
> octave:4> digits(100)
> ans =  100
> octave:5> Pi
> ans =
> 
> 3.141592653589793238462643383279502884197169399375105820974944592307816406286208998628034825342117067982148
> octave:6>  
> 
> ...
> octave:14> x = sym('x');
> octave:15> y = sym('y');
> octave:16> [foom bar] = numden((x^2 + x + 1)/(y^3 + y + 2))
> foom =
> 
> 1.0+x+x^(2.0)
> bar =
> 
> 2.0+y^(3.0)+y
> octave:17>
> 
> ".
